Guys Please Help Me .


sbnisan

Question

hi all,

Today i faced a serious problem in my FB15(automatic transmission). In the morning when i start the car it displayed red battery indicator, saying that battery problem is there. I ignored that and drove for about 10 KM, an suddenly the car stopped in the middle of the road. And it showed all the indicators. And after a minute i could start the vehicle and could drive it for another 2km, and then it stopped it again. and this scenario happened 4 more times, and i however managed park it at office. Now i cant drive it back to any place,

i can start and drive for 100m and then it stops. and i can start again after some time.

Has anybody experienced such problem ?. please help me do diagnose the problem. And please recommend me a way to get it fixed at my place(wellawatta), or a way how i can tow it back home/garage...

please... help me ASP . (need a way to go home :)

Hi.. Guys,

It is great to have a set of nice people willing to help each other when one is in trouble. I greatly appreciate your advices.

Finally i could solve the problem. I took the vehicle to a alternator repairing place and they diagnosed that the voltage regulator IC of the alternator is bad.(they said due to a water leak) . Before repairing the alternator battery voltage was around 11.75-12.25V. now it goes upto 13.85V. Now the vehicle is doing pretty well. Thanks again for all your valuable responses...

great to hear that you got the issue sorted :)

regulators are funny things...too little voltage and your battery won't charge and too much of it also won't make the battery charge :)

I've had a similar issue sometime back and the regulator was the culprit :)
